High-yield production of erythritol from raw glycerol in fed-batch cultures of Yarrowia lipolytica

Abstract: An acetate-negative mutant of Yarrowia lipolytica Wratislavia K1 was selected that, when grown with 300 g raw glycerol l(-1) at pH 3, produced 170 g erythritol l(-1) after 7 days, corresponding to a 56% yield and a productivity of 1 g l(-1) h(-1). The Wratislavia K1 strain did not produce citric acid.

“…The application of crude glycerol at 13.3 Hz and 0.6 min -1 resulted in erythritol concentration of 58.2 g/L, yield of 0.38 g/g and productivity of 0.78 g/(L·h). On the other hand, Rymowicz et al (9) reported that in the fed-batch cultivation the application of crude glycerol (300 g/L) with Y. lipolytica Wratislavia K1 resulted in a higher concentration of erythritol (170 g/L) with the same yield of erythritol production of 0.56 g/g and lower productivity of 1.0 g/(L·h) than in the present study. Bett er results were obtained by Tomaszewska et al (13) when using the parental strain Y. lipolytica Wratislavia K1 in the fed-batch system with pulsed addition of glycerol (325 g/L).…”
